Prosecutors said police examined WhatsApp phone messages between the co-defendants and other members of staff which revealed a 'culture of abuse'.

A nurse and healthcare worker who have been found guilty of unlawfully drugging patients sent WhatsApp messages to each other in which they bragged about sedating those in their care. Catherine Hudson, 54, and Charlotte Wilmot, 48, ill-treated those in their care on a stroke unit at Blackpool Victoria Hospital in Lancashire between February 2017 and November 2018, Preston Crown Court heard.

'I sedated one to within an inch of her life' They said the messages were not supposed to be taken seriously, claiming the 'gallows humour' was the venting of their frustrations at working in a chronically understaffed unit. 'Sedated all the troublemakers Nurse and healthcare workers stole drugs Hudson was also convicted of stealing Mebeverine, a medication intended for an end-of-life patient.
